20090277331HYDROGEN SEPARATION COMPOSITE MEMBRANE MODULE AND THE METHOD OF PRODUCTION THEREOF - This invention relates to a metallic composite membrane for separating hydrogen from a mixed gas, a membrane module and a manufacturing method thereof. The composite membrane consists of a three-layer sandwich structure, e.g. the porous metal substrate, an intermediate layer and the hydrogen-selective dense thin metal layer. In the embodiments of the invention, the porous metal substrates were first pretreated to reduce their surface roughness without reducing their gas permeability. The pretreated substrates were coated with intermediate layer, wherein the intermediate layer served as not only a barrier layer to prevent interdiffusion between the substrate and the hydrogen-selective layer, but also a surface modifier to reduce surface roughness and pore size of the substrate. A hydrogen-selective metal layer was then deposited on the intermediate layer-coated substrate by coating methods. Since the substrate with the intermediate layer has a smoother surface with a smaller pore size, a thinner hydrogen-selective metal membrane can be used to form a dense pinhole-free membrane. This not only reduces the metal loading of the composite membrane, but also increases its hydrogen permeance and selectivity of the composite membrane. The module design according to the invention provides solutions to the problems that result from high welding temperatures or high mechanical compressing force caused by the joining of a composite membrane with other parts through Swagelok, welding, brazing and gasket etc.11-12-2009
20140170328ELECTROLESS PLATING OF RUTHENIUM AND RUTHENIUM-PLATED PRODUCTS - An electroless plating Ru bath for the deposition of Ru on the surface of a substrate comprises a Ru stock solution and hydrazine as a reducing reagent. Ru layers may be applied, for example, for use in membranes for the separation of hydrogen gas from mixtures of gases or to protect materials from corrosion. An example Ru stock solution comprises Ru chloride, hydrochloric acid, ammonia, nitrite salt, alkali hydroxide, and deionized water. The electroless plating bath may be applied to deposit ruthenium layers onto palladium layers to prepare Pd—Ru composite or alloy membranes or multilayer Pd—Ru composite or alloy membranes. Such membranes have example application to the separation of hydrogen from mixtures of gases.06-19-2014

20110011070Ni-25 Heat-Resistent Nodular Graphite Cast Iron For Use In Exhaust Systems - A nodular graphite, heat-resistant cast iron composition for use in engine systems. The composition contains carbon 1.5-2.4 weight %, silicon 5.4-7.0 weight %, manganese 0.5-1.5 weight %, nickel 22.0-28.0 weight %, chromium 1.5-3.0 weight %, molybdenum 0.1-1.0 weight %, magnesium 0.03-0.1 weight %, and a balance weight % being substantially iron. The composition has an austenitic matrix. Additionally, the composition exhibits excellent oxidation resistance at high temperature and excellent mechanical properties at both room and high temperatures. Thus, the composition can be a lower cost substitute material for Ni-Resist D5S under thermocycling conditions experienced by exhaust gas accessories and housings such as engine exhaust manifolds, turbocharger housings, and catalytic converter housings.01-20-2011

20110089328ELECTROKINETIC MICROFLUIDIC FLOW CYTOMETER APPARATUSES WITH DIFFERENTIAL RESISTIVE PARTICLE COUNTING AND OPTICAL SORTING - An electrokinetic microfluidic flow cytometer apparatus can include a substrate, a pair of signal and noise detection channels, and a particle detection circuit. The substrate includes an input port, an output port, and a microchannel that fluidly connects the input port and the output port to allow fluid to flow therebetween. The signal and noise detection channels are defined in the substrate and are fluidly connected to the microchannel from locations that are adjacent to each other. The signal and noise detection channels extend in opposite directions away from the microchannel to receive ambient electrical noise. The particle detection circuit is electrically connected to the signal and noise detection channels and generates a particle detection signal in response to a differential voltage across the signal and noise detection channels, which tracks changes in resistivity across an adjacent portion of the microchannel as particles within the fluid move responsive to an electric field along that portion of the microchannel, while at least substantially canceling a common component of the ambient electrical noise received by the signal and noise detection channels. A particle counting circuit counts a number of particles that move through the sensing gate in response to pulses in the particle detection signal.04-21-2011

20110173953System And Method For Regenerating An Engine Exhaust After-Treatment Device - A system and method for regenerating a device in an engine exhaust after-treatment system is provided. To regenerate the device, a syngas stream is introduced into the engine exhaust stream and combusts in the presence of a catalyst in the after-treatment system, raising the temperature. A supplemental liquid fuel stream is then selectively introduced into and is vaporized by the syngas stream to form a combined fuel stream. Combustion of the combined fuel stream with the engine exhaust in the presence of the catalyst further heats the device bringing it to a temperature suitable for regeneration. The catalyst can be upstream of or within the device being regenerated.07-21-2011

20110112195Potent and Selective Inhibition by Aurinticarboxylic Acid - The severe acute respiratory syndrome virus (SARS) is a coronavirus that instigated regional epidemics in Canada and several Asian countries in 2003. The newly identified SARS coronavirus (SARS-CoV) can be transmitted among humans and cause severe or even fatal illnesses. As preventive vaccine development takes years to complete and adverse reactions have been reported to some veterinary coronaviral vaccines, anti-viral compounds must be relentlessly pursued. In this study, we analyzed the effect of aurintricarboxylic acid (ATA) on SARS-CoV replication in cell culture, and found that ATA could drastically inhibit SARS-CoV replication, with viral production being more than 1000 fold than that in the untreated control. ATA is also shown to be an effective anti-viral for several other viruses, including West Nile Virus and variola virus.05-12-2011
